Elemental(Pb Sn As Sb Bi) Analysis Low Alloy Steel By Inductively Coupled Plasma Mass Spectrometer ICP-MS

Five harmful elements in low alloy steel (Pb, Sn, As, Sb, Bi) have adverse effectson the performance of the steel. It is very difficult to detect the effects because of theextremely low amount of these five elements in low alloy steel and mutualinterference among the ingredients. There are many methods to analyze five harmfulelements by hydride atomic absorption spectrometer, but most of them need to addmasking agent with the purpose of eliminating interference and reducing the signal ofanalysis element. In addition, trival detection process, big workload, long testingperiod are attributed to the limitation of the methods. The present work useinductively coupled plasma source mass spectrometer(ICP-MS)to measure the Pb、Sn、As、Sb、Bi in in low alloy steel, so set up a kind of fast and accurate method toanalyze five harmful elements in low alloy steel.In the experiment, acid dissolution method and microwave digestion system wereadopted to dissolve the sample and by contrast, the acid dissolution method wasemployed as sample dissolution methods. The work used hydrochloric acid and nitricacid to dissolve the sample, selected75As,118Sn,121Sb,208Pb,209Bi as isotope ofthe the analytic element and added the rhodium internal standard and iron base tocalibrate the influence of matrix effect on the result. Experimental results show that:the correlation coefficient of the calibration curves of Pb, Sn, As, Sb, Bi was above0.999; relative standard deviation (n=10) was0.018%,0.0094%,0.026%,0.036%,0.048%; detection limits were:0.00002%,0.00007%,0.0001%,0.00009%,0.00001%;recoveries rate were:98.9%,100.3%,99.0%,96.6%,100.5%, respectively. Therepeated experiment demonstrated that the method is simple and easy to operateduring sample dissolution process. Moreover, the period of experimental analysis isshort and the accuracy and precision of analysis can meet the analytical requirements.
